What the Duct Fitting Pressure Loss is for
Calculate fitting pressure loss from entered loss coefficient and velocity pressure.
A fan must move the required airflow through the whole air path. Straight duct, fittings, filters, coils, terminals, and measurement locations all affect the pressure picture.

The relationship
The formula used here
Δp=K·ρv²/2.
This calculator applies that relationship to your entries. Use the formula to check that the units, reference condition, and measurement location make sense together.
